Tyla Announces Lagos Concert as Part of First-Ever Headline World Tour

South African music star Tyla is bringing her highly anticipated A*POP World Tour to Lagos, with the Nigerian stop scheduled for December 22 at a venue yet to be announced.

The Lagos concert forms part of the singer’s first full headline global tour, a 34-date run supporting her sophomore album, APOP*, which was released on July 24. Announced on Monday and presented by Live Nation, the tour marks Tyla’s biggest international outing to date, spanning Europe, North America and Africa.

The tour kicks off in Paris on October 12 before travelling through major European cities including Amsterdam, London, Glasgow, Manchester, Brussels, Berlin, Stockholm, Oslo and Copenhagen. It then heads to North America from November 12, with performances in cities such as Sacramento, San Francisco, Vancouver, Chicago, Boston, New York, Houston, Los Angeles and Las Vegas.

Lagos will be the first African stop on the tour, ahead of Cape Town on January 4, 2027, and Johannesburg on January 9, bringing the global trek to a close on home soil.

Fans can access artist presale tickets from Wednesday, July 29, while general ticket sales begin on Friday, July 31 at 10 a.m. local time. Additional ticket details and tour information are available on Tyla’s official website.

Born Tyla Laura Seethal in Johannesburg, the singer shot to international fame in 2023 with her breakout hit Water, which helped introduce amapiano-inspired music to a wider global audience. She went on to make history by winning the inaugural Grammy Award for Best African Music Performance in 2024, before earning a second Grammy the following year. In 2025, she also received Billboard’s Impact Award in recognition of her contribution to taking African music to audiences around the world.
